Providing more movies and TV shows to you is a constant focus for us here at Zip.ca.

We are implementing numerous changes to improve your experience with Zip.ca, including efforts to test a new bar code system in partnership with Canada Post to track and improve the time it takes to ship your DVD’s. Please remember to use ZipRefill when you send your DVD’s back to us.

When you ZipRefill:

  • We ship you another ZipListed title before the one you returned arrives at our distribution center
  • You get ZipReward points!
  • We can use the information to track and improve shipping times

On the content front, we are continuing to buy more copies and more titles. This year alone our additions have brought our catalogue to more than 80,000 titles. Our Movie and TV library will continue to grow every month in both quantity and quality.  We are completely dedicated to seeing your service get better and better.

Streaming — What and When

At Zip.ca our approach to streaming is to bring our members the hottest new releases as well as titles from previous years, in the simplest and most cost-effective ways. The streaming service we are bringing to Canadians involves co-coordinating both studios and hardware companies in parallel. We are in the late stages of negotiating with all the major Hollywood Studios, some Canadian content holders and all the major brands of equipment manufacturers. This means that when we launch, you will be able to stream new releases as well as older content and it will be widely available on name brand manufacturers of TV’s, Blu-Ray players, game consoles and computers. We are excited to bring you our streaming service and will communicate the dates it will be available as soon as we can.

For those of you who may have heard of streaming but may not know how it works we will make sure your experience with Zip.ca remains easy. You will still maintain one ZipList and be able to decide if you would like your movies and TV shows mailed or streamed.
